When doing comparisons, do not consider or refer to percentage quality difference shown in this game. Difference in percentage quality of teams in this game is misleading, and clearly is the higher you move up in the levels. Use difference in terms of quality points.
Those what some are referring to as ‘bot teams’ are not bot teams. They are what seem to be abandoned teams (that too, some may not be fully abandoned teams). Bot teams are those teams usually found in the lower league levels (L1-L3), that can be recognisable by their names. In this game, teams can be classified as bot teams, abandoned teams, semi-active teams, active tams but with manager mostly absent from the bench, active teams with manager present, and special bot teams (only one more likely, which is Mourinho FC). Do you notice the order I have listed them? This is the expected order in terms of difficulty someone should expect when playing against. Bot teams play at low level; any decent team with decent formation will beat them. Mourinho FC is a special case; do not compare it with others. Mourinho FC is the sort of team that plays at the highest level or close to highest, where the bot counters your team settings for every simulated bit of the match. That does not mean it can’t be beaten. To compare, it is like you are a playing a video game in legendary mode, but you can still beat the game in this mode.

Going by football logic, force counters-attacks would be for defensive and at most normal mentalities while attacking and hard attacking with force counter-attacks are expected to be bad combinations, but not in this game. In this game, people have been using combinations like hard attacking, force-counter attack, high pressing and so on and still winning, and in the past, following assistant manager's advice during some particular matches lead to what would be bad or inappropriate combinations in nearly all situations in real football but seem to be the good or appropriate combinations to use in Top Eleven.
